>I want to save files inside a SQL Server table.
>The table has a column of type image
>
>I have a remote view pointing to this table
>
>I put the file in memory with filetostr
>I replace the remote view's memo field with the memory string
>Finally I tableupdate the view.
>
>This works fine.
>But I have a problem with large files. If the file is large, I can put it completely in the memo field. But only the first 16 Mb gets saved in the SQL Server Table.
